Transaction df59a31d8e10f927029f139e08ed81d1b34e26b2afd01a26f4e5c1d16ed0db52
2 Input
2 Outputs
- df59a31d8e10f927029f139e08ed81d1b34e26b2afd01a26f4e5c1d16ed0db52:0
- df59a31d8e10f927029f139e08ed81d1b34e26b2afd01a26f4e5c1d16ed0db52:1
value 65800000
address 18LLGdJbvTe6CDkgUaiv3NYS2STCpYdxXP
value 37344946
address 1AjWRqoVWhtvVPtc1SxsmMUnuNF1NTheZP